Manitowish Waters Bike Trail nearing goal

By StarJournal
October 5, 2012
469
0
Share:

The Manitowish Waters Bike Trail, Inc would like to announce that they are nearing their goal for the first phase of the bike trail extension. The Manitowish Waters Bike Trail Inc. is a 501 (c) (3) non-profit that has been established for the sole purpose of raising funds for the development and maintenance of the Manitowish Waters bike trail system. This first phase is being done solely with donations and will extend from Rest Lake Park/Discovery Center to Red Feather Road/Camp Jorn. The main focus of this trail is safety. Summer traffic, bicycles and walkers have become too numerous to share the county highways and this trail will alleviate a part of that dangerous congestion.

Currently, we are $20,000 away from making this first phase a reality, thanks to many generous donors. We plan to get this first phase completed this year, with construction starting within a week. While this phase is being completed, we will continue our fund raising efforts to proceed from Red Feather Road to the North Lakeland School. Mercer has a grant, which will allow them to proceed along Hwy. 51 to connect with the Manitowish Waters trails.

Our ultimate long range goal is the connection to Boulder Junction, Sayner trail system, with a scenic ride or walk across Cty. K, and areas beyond, making Manitowish Waters a trail system destination.
